LibGfx: Make Painter::draw_rect() scale-aware

Needed for the window server minimize animation.

draw_rect() can't just call draw_line() because that isn't
draw_op()-aware. The draw_op()-awareness in Painter looks a bit ad-hoc,
but that's for another day.
